中級編

Python

Pythonで始めるasyncpg入門:非同期PostgreSQLドライバを使いこなそう

PythonでPostgreSQLにアクセスする際、psycopg2などの同期ドライバを使うのが一般的ですが、非同期処理と組み合わせるとパフォーマンスを最大限に引き出せる場面があります。本記事では、非同期対応のPostgreSQLドライバで...
Python

初心者向けPython入門:psycopg2で始めるPostgreSQL操作

PythonでPostgreSQLを操作する際、最もポピュラーなライブラリがpsycopg2です。本記事では、初心者の方でもつまずかないよう、インストールから基本的な接続・CRUD操作、エラーハンドリングまで解説します。最後に演習問題とその...
Python

PythonとSQLite入門:はじめてのデータベース操作ガイド

本記事では、Python初心者を対象に、組み込み型データベース「SQLite」を使ったデータ操作の基本を解説します。SQLiteはサーバー不要で手軽に使えるため、ちょっとしたデータの保存や試作プロジェクトにも最適です。この記事を読むことで、...
Python

Pythonでクラスとオブジェクトを作成してOOPを理解する

Pythonの「クラス」は、オブジェクト指向プログラミング(OOP)の核となる機能であり、関連するデータ(属性)や処理(メソッド)をひとまとめにする仕組みです。これにより、コードの再利用性や可読性を大幅に高めます。本記事では、クラスの基本か...
Python

Python入門:オブジェクト指向プログラミングの継承・ポリモーフィズム・カプセル化を理解する

Pythonはシンプルで表現力豊かなプログラミング言語として知られており、業務アプリケーションやWebサービス、機械学習、データ解析など幅広い分野で利用されています。本記事では、その中心的な特徴である「オブジェクト指向プログラミング(OOP...
Python

Python OOP入門:変数の種類とスコープを理解しよう

Pythonのオブジェクト指向プログラミング(OOP)では、変数の種類やその「スコープ(有効範囲)」を正しく理解することが非常に重要です。本記事では、初級者向けに以下の内容を丁寧に解説します。これらをマスターすれば、クラス設計やデバッグが格...
VBScript

VBScriptでスクリプトの最適化: 効率的なコード作成のためのガイド

VBScript(Visual Basic Scripting Edition)は、Windows環境で自動化スクリプトを作成する際に広く使われるプログラミング言語です。シンプルな構文と強力な機能を提供しますが、大規模なスクリプトや複雑な処...
VBScript

VBScriptでレジストリを操作する方法と基本的な使い方

VBScript(Visual Basic Scripting Edition)は、Windows環境で幅広く使用されているスクリプト言語の一つです。特に、Windowsのシステム管理や自動化スクリプトとして利用されることが多く、その中でも...
VBScript

VBScriptでCOMオブジェクトを使用してExcelやWordを操作する方法

VBScriptは、Windows環境でよく使用されるスクリプト言語で、COM(Component Object Model)オブジェクトを利用して、ExcelやWordといったMicrosoft Office製品を操作することができます。...
VBScript

VBScriptのCOMオブジェクトでWindowsの機能を制御する方法

VBScriptは、簡易的なスクリプト言語であり、Windows環境においてさまざまなタスクを自動化するために使用されます。その中でも、COM(Component Object Model)オブジェクトを利用することで、Windowsの多く...
VBScript

VBScriptにおけるクラスの定義とインスタンス化の基本

VBScriptは、主にWindows環境で使用されるスクリプト言語です。比較的簡単に学べ、システム管理や簡単なアプリケーションの作成に適しています。本記事では、VBScriptでのクラスの定義方法と、インスタンスの作成について詳しく解説し...
VBScript

VBScriptにおけるオブジェクト指向プログラミングの概念と実践

VBScript(Visual Basic Scripting Edition)は、Microsoftによって開発されたスクリプト言語であり、主にWebページやWindowsベースのアプリケーションの自動化に使用されています。VBScrip...
VBScript

VBScriptのOn Error ステートメントとは?エラー処理の基本と応用

プログラムを書いていると、予期しないエラーに遭遇することがあります。エラーが発生した場合、プログラムが突然停止してしまうと、ユーザーに不便をかけるだけでなく、システムに大きな影響を与える可能性があります。これを防ぐために、プログラミング言語...
SQL Server

SQL Serverのカバリングインデックス:効率的なクエリを実現する仕組みと活用法

データベースのパフォーマンスを最適化するためには、適切なインデックスの設計が重要です。その中でも「カバリングインデックス(Covering Index)」は、特定のクエリを高速化する強力なツールです。本記事では、SQL Serverにおける...
VBScript

VBScriptでファイル操作をマスターするための6選

VBScript(Visual Basic Scripting Edition)は、Windows環境でのファイル操作を効率的に行うための強力なツールです。今回は、VBScriptを使用してファイルの作成、読み取り、書き込み、コピー、削除、...
VBScript

VBScriptでWindows11のシステム仕様要件を取得するサンプルコード

Windows 10 22H2のサポート期間の終了が2025年10月14日までで、まだまだ先だから大丈夫とはいえない状況になってきています。皆さんもWindows 10からWindows 11へアップグレードしようと考えてるのではないでしょ...
VBScript

VBScriptで改行を考慮した文字の置換のサンプルコード

Accessのレポートオブジェクトのコントロール値などのオブジェクトの文字を他の文字に置き換えるとき、改行文字が含まれていて置換できないって経験があるのではないでしょうか?私自身がその経験があり、改行文字を考慮した置換を紹介しているサイトが...
VBScript

VBScriptでテキストファイルの文字コードを判定後に文字データを取得するサンプルコード

ファイルを読み込むときに文字コードを判別せずに文字コードを指定すると、文字化けになって苦労します。業務の場合だと、文字化けになるからこの文字コードでファイルを作成してと指定しているところもあるのではないでしょうか?システムに理解のある取引先...
VBScript

VBScriptのエラーオブジェクト:基礎から応用まで詳しく解説

VBScriptは、Windows環境で多くの自動化やスクリプト作成に使用されているスクリプト言語です。特に、システム管理やアプリケーションの簡単な操作を自動化するために用いられることが多いです。しかし、プログラムの実行中には様々なエラーが...
SQL Server

SQL Serverのトリガーのパフォーマンス考慮:トリガーがシステムに与える影響を理解する

SQL Serverのトリガーは非常に便利な機能であり、特定のイベントが発生した際に自動的に実行される処理を定義できます。しかし、適切に設計・管理されていないトリガーは、パフォーマンスに悪影響を及ぼす可能性があります。本記事では、トリガーが...